I've two problems with m-bib:

a) I want to have the cites numbered by occurrence like this [1], [2],
   etc. I managed to get 1, 2, 3 etc. in the reference list but
   in the text I get [23], [5] etc. where this number is the number of
   occurrence in the .bib file. I used:
    \setuppublications[alternative=apa]
    \setuppublications[numbering=yes,refcommand=num] %,refcommand=number]

b) I'm using \cite[reference1, reference2] but I get only
   [23], i.e. one reference shown in the text. In the reference list they
   appear both.

I still have this problem.

> b) I'm using \cite[reference1, reference2] but I get only
>    [23], i.e. one reference shown in the text. In the reference list they
>    appear both.
This problem vanishes if I use refcommand=number instead of
refcommand=num.
